Key Differences
In short — Ryzen 5 2400G outperforms the cheaper Core i3-540 on the selected game parameters. However, the worse performing Core i3-540 is a better bang for your buck. The better performing Ryzen 5 2400G is 2958 days newer than the cheaper Core i3-540.
Advantages of Intel Core i3-540
- Up to 56% cheaper than Ryzen 5 2400G - $43.86 vs $98.71
- Up to 53% better value when playing Elden Ring than Ryzen 5 2400G - $0.44 vs $0.94 per FPS
Advantages of AMD Ryzen 5 2400G
- Performs up to 6% better in Elden Ring than Core i3-540 - 117 vs 110 FPS
- Consumes up to 11% less energy than Intel Core i3-540 - 65 vs 73 Watts
- Can execute more multi-threaded tasks simultaneously than Intel Core i3-540 - 8 vs 4 threads

Intel Core i3-540 | vs | AMD Ryzen 5 2400G |
---|---|---|
Jan 7th, 2010 | Release Date | Feb 12th, 2018 |
Core i3 | Collection | Ryzen 5 |
Clarkdale | Codename | Raven Ridge |
Intel Socket 1156 | Socket | AMD Socket AM4 |
Desktop | Segment | Desktop |
2 | Cores | 4 |
4 | Threads | 8 |
3.1 GHz | Base Clock Speed | 3.6 GHz |
Non-Turbo | Turbo Clock Speed | 3.9 GHz |
73 W | TDP | 65 W |
32 nm | Process Size | 14 nm |
23.0x | Multiplier | 36.0x |
Intel HD | Integrated Graphics | Radeon RX Vega 11 |
No | Overclockable | Yes |
